Enterprise Financial Group, which provides consumer and vehicle protection programs to the retail automotive and powersports markets, has received approval in Arizona for a new motorcycle protection service contract (PSMP).
The program introduces two primary coverage triggers: “BOSS” coverage, which begins after the manufacturer warranty expires, and “THROTTLE” coverage, which starts at the time of sale for vehicles without existing warranty coverage.
Contracts include a $50 standard deductible, with optional features such as zero-deductible upgrades and coverage for modified bikes, including trike or chopper conversions.
Coverage is backed by reimbursement insurance, allowing policyholders to file claims directly with the insurer if the provider fails to pay, adding a layer of financial security to the structure.
The product excludes commercial-use vehicles and is positioned as an optional add-on rather than a condition of financing or purchase.
